Hey y’all, every get sick of hammerdins, blizzard/ Nova sorcs, javazons, etc?
One of my Favorite things to do in d2r was to take something that in concept that shouldn’t work and figure out a way to make it viable, or at least to test out it’s limits. I’ve had varying levels of success, from The Summoner barb to the Brand Crossbow wielding necro to the max level Valkyrie Amazon there are some fun builds that are at least worth a token just to see what they can do.
So what’s your Favorite build that is never on a tier list but you still love playing?

There used to be a guy called SSoG who created all sorts of wacky but somewhat viable builds.
My favourite was called the Invincible Abbott - basically, you stack so much damage reduction, absorb and self heal that you can't die.

Spearazon!
I have solo'ed a spearazon from A1 Normal to Hell Baal many, many times, starting in 1.09.
All I need is a Lycander's Flank, a rogue merc, and I'm good to go.

I went Blade Fury assassin just because it is slept on. Then I found out it's good for Ubers. And trust me it is with the right setup and fairly budget. Then I wanted to level and clear out tons of monsters quickly... After playing around, I figured out using the Destruction runeword on the weapon is completely insane with Blade Fury. I put it in a Phase Blade for multi-purpose uses. Players 8 Smackdown!!! My recommendation for the mercenary is act one rogue with Harmony to stack with Burst of Speed because we're not teleporting. I know Destruction isn't cheap but if you have it, this is probably the funnest way to use it.

IIRC, there was a bug in the understanding of the mechanics, so it wasn't 1 attack per 2 frames but rather per 3 frames, even though everything known at the time said that it should have been 2 frames.fredkid wrote: 7 months agoCouldn't understand how he reach the 12.5 attacks per second...
is it some old bug?
(on maxroll I could reach only 5 attacks per second max with the Bear normal attack with the Assassin...)
It was still an utter Beast.
I was active on the AB at the time and i played in a game where 2 people were testing that build at the same time, and they just ripped everything apart.
Rest of us could relax, follow along and just watch the mayhem.
The truly amazing part however, is this quote from his description:
"Anyway, back to the guide. If you’ve read any of my guides, you know that I place a high value on Skill point flexibility. I like to have the core of my build completed in under 40 points, if possible, so that I have a lot of points leftover for variants. Well, this build sets a new record for skill point flexibility- one which I’m reasonably confident shall never be broken. You see, Ursa Major relies entirely on an oskill and standard attack. The build is completed without ever investing a single skill point. How’s THAT for flexible?"
That's definitely hard to beat!

You could read the AB link?
Outdated, but definitely better than my Memory. ^_^
Anyway, Beast runeword on Assassin, the Werebear transformation combined with Fanaticism and normal attack apparently worked out, interestingly.
Based on looking at the calculators linked, i assume it was a bug of some form that was fixed in D2R...
And they've definitely changed how IAS works, so even if it wasn't a bug, that alone probably would have removed this exploit.
But the effect of high percentage crushing blow and over 8 attacks per second was pretty much hilariously effective.
